Hayling Golf Club
Hayling Golf Club The Hayling Golf Club was founded in 1883 by members of the Sandeman family. The club has a rich history involving many celebrities, wartime activities, and improvements by well-known course architects. Harmison To Defend English Disability Title
Harmison To Defend English Disability Title THE third English Disability Open will return to The Warwickshire Golf Club this weekend, when Northumberland’s Kevin Harmison will defend his title.
